Summary:A new protocol to access CF3‐containing bispiro[isoquinolone‐pyrrolidine‐benzothiophenone]s was described. A series of 1,3‐dipoles were synthesized from isoquinolinetrione and CF3CH2NH2. In the presence of 10 mol% DABCO, the 1,3‐dipolar cycloaddition of isoquinolinedione trifluoroethyl ketimines and unsaturated benzothiophenones delivered corresponding adducts in excellent yields (up to 98 %) and diastereoselectivities (up to >20 : 1 dr). An efficient and mild method to access CF3‐containing bispiro[isoquinolone‐pyrrolidine‐benzothiophenone]s is reported.
